We offer you an exclusive pen dedicated to St. Sergius of Radonezh (c. 1314-1392), the abbot of the Russian Church, the patron saint of Russia and the founder of a number of monasteries, including the Holy Trinity Monastery near Moscow (now the Trinity-Sergius Lavra).
Russian Russian pen's artistic solution is based on the image of Sergius of Radonezh, the spiritual collector of the Russian people, who is associated with the cultural ideal of Holy Russia and the emergence of Russian spiritual culture, the work of famous masters of lacquer miniature of the Kholuysky Art Factory.
Russian Russian Orthodox Church has been venerated as a saint in the face of the venerable since the XV century and is considered the greatest Russian ascetic of the Russian land, who blessed Dmitry Donskoy to fight Mamai before the Battle of Kulikovo.
His name is associated with the restoration of Orthodox Russian churches after the invasion of the Mongol-Tatars, therefore St. Sergius of Radonezh is considered the patron saint of builders and architects, as well as students. A pen with the image of Sergius of Radonezh in the hand-painted technique can become a unique gift and a kind of talisman for all who consider this saint their patron saint.
A portrait of St. Sergius of Radonezh is depicted on the cap of the pen in the technique of lacquer miniature by the masters of iconography. The first words of the prayer to Sergius of Radonezh are engraved on the wide silver rim of the pen.
The body and cap of the pen are made of black acrylic resin, the clip of the pen and the rim on the cap are made of 925 sterling silver, the pen is made of 18K gold.
The individual number is printed on the silver rim of the cap.
